New Othin Spake cd out now

Filed under: glasvocht releases — filip @ 5:23 am



Othin Spake: “Child Of Deception And Skill” (cd, limited edition of 500 copies)

Two years after “the Ankh”, Othin Spake’s new album “Child of Deception and Skill” is out now on Glasvocht Records and Rat Records.
The material on the album is a complete free improvisation recorded in 2005 (at the same time the Ankh was recorded) at “Depot 214″ by Joël Grignard.
In fact this music is recorded the second time the band came together.
Othin Spake decided to release two more cd’s from that period (this one and their first concert in Archiduc later 2008) before releasing in 2009 a cd they recorded with guests Trevor Dunn, Shelley Burgon, Andrew d’Angelo, Magic Malik, Fred Vanhove, Andrew Claes and Bruno Vansina.
The music on “Child of Deception and Skill” was recorded at the very beginning of the band’s existence (just before the “The Ankh” concert and is released as a document of how the band played at that time.
The music on the record is a full improvisation and is put on the record as it was played.
The incredible sound comes from producer-musician-soundman Pierre Vervloesem (X-Legged Sally, FES, PVTV and producer of numerous cd’s and bands). He mixed and mastered march 2008.
The sleeve of the record is a design by Filip Gheysen, the cd packaging a design of Peter Verbruggen and the infosheet a design by Teun Verbruggen.

Some info on Othin Spake:

In March 2005 drummer Teun Verbruggen (Jef Neve trio, Flat Earth Society…) invited the eccentric guitar player Mauro Pawlowski (dEUS, Somnambula) and piano-Rhodes wizard Jozef Dumoulin (Mäâk Spirit, Magic Malik, Octurn…) to play a single session based on pure improvisation. The result left most people wondering how the categorize what they had just heard and landed them gigs in Jazz Middelheim, the Petrol and the Flanders Jazz Meeting .Two years later the band have played at many Jazz venues both in Belgium and abroad, released the first cd of a trilogy and invited bass legend Trevor Dunn (Mr. Bungle, Fantomâs, John Zorn) and New York harpist extraordinaire Shelley Burgon to play at Bluenoterecordsfestival, Gand.
They played with Fred Vanhove at Northseajazz and with Andrew d’Angelo at Motives for Jazz, Belgium.
They will release a cd with these guests in January 2009.
